Job Description

* Job Title: * Medical Assistant * Location: * Charlotte, NC (will travel to Pineville office when needed) * Duration: * 3 Months (possibility of extension) * Shift: * 8 AM – 5 PM (Mon-Fri) * Roles & Responsibilities: * · Provide technical support to patients, assist them with the registration process, answer patient questions in person and over the phone, including outreach to patients. · Train local teams on the registration process and support transition of technology systems · Occasional travel to other office locations to support training events. · Capture relevant information about the patient’s health and healthcare experience while rooming patients, taking vitals, administering point-of-care testing, and performing standard age and condition-appropriate screening assessments. · Assist with the coordination of post-visit care by scheduling appointments with specialists, coordinating referrals, and sharing information to the patient’s internal and external care team · Collaborate with providers to monitor the health of a panel of patients and determine if they are up to date on preventive measures. · Participate in the daily operations of a primary care practice, such as answering incoming phone calls, responding to emails, assisting with front desk inquiries, and ensuring the general upkeep of the clinical space. · Assist in providing patient education on chronic disease management and coach patients using an action-planning model based on motivational interviewing techniques · Provide anticipatory preventive guidance to families with children by establishing healing relationships with members and families. *Requirements:* · Standard Health Coach requirement: At least 1 year of experience in a high touch customer service or patient facing role in a healthcare setting required. · Strong written and verbal communication skills. · Experience working on collaborative, diverse and feedback-driven multi-disciplinary teams · A proven track record of persisting through change, demonstrating a forward-thinking perspective when under pressure, and consistently stepping up to act on challenges. · Proficiency in computer technology such as typing, navigating the internet, working with new mobile smartphone applications, and using multiple software systems simultaneously. * * *Parking:* Free onsite parking at both offices
